In today's fast-paced tech industry, where businesses strive to stay ahead of their competition, traditional project management methodologies often fall short. This is where Agile Project Management with Scrum comes into play, revolutionizing the way projects are planned, executed, and delivered.

Scrum is a framework that enables teams to work collaboratively, adapt to changing requirements, and deliver high-quality products in shorter time frames. It emphasizes transparency, communication, and iterative development, making it the go-to choice for many software development teams around the world.

Increased Flexibility and Adaptability

Unlike traditional project management methodologies, where requirements and plans are set in stone at the beginning of a project, Scrum embraces change. It allows teams to adapt to evolving customer needs, market trends, and unforeseen challenges along the way.

Scrum achieves this by breaking down projects into small, manageable units called sprints. Each sprint typically lasts for a few weeks, during which the team focuses on delivering a specific set of features or functionalities. At the end of each sprint, the team reviews the progress and adjusts the project plan accordingly.

This iterative approach promotes flexibility, enabling teams to respond quickly to feedback and changing priorities. It ensures that the final product aligns with the latest requirements and delivers maximum value to the customers.

Improved Collaboration and Communication

Effective collaboration and communication are essential for the success of any project. Scrum provides a structured framework that encourages transparency, teamwork, and open communication within the team and with stakeholders.

In Scrum, all team members are involved in the planning, decision-making, and execution process. They work together in cross-functional teams, ensuring that everyone has a clear understanding of the project goals and their respective responsibilities.

Regular meetings, such as daily stand-ups and sprint reviews, keep everyone informed about the project's progress and any potential issues. This constant communication helps identify and address problems proactively, leading to faster resolution and a more streamlined workflow.

Continuous Improvement and Quality Control

With Scrum, continuous improvement is at the core of the project management process. The team regularly reflects on their performance, identifies areas for improvement, and takes action to enhance their productivity and deliverables.

At the end of each sprint, the team conducts a retrospective meeting, where they discuss what went well, what could be improved, and any lessons learned. This feedback loop allows them to refine their processes, eliminate bottlenecks, and optimize their performance in the subsequent sprints.

Furthermore, Scrum promotes a culture of quality control. The team focuses on delivering "potentially shippable" increments of the product at the end of each sprint. This means that each sprint delivers a fully functional feature that has undergone rigorous testing and meets the predefined quality standards.

Enhanced Stakeholder Engagement

Engaging stakeholders throughout the project is crucial for its success. Scrum facilitates stakeholder involvement through regular feedback sessions and the prioritization of features based on their needs and expectations.

By collaborating with stakeholders at every stage, Scrum ensures that their voices are heard, and their requirements are met. This not only increases customer satisfaction but also helps in building strong and lasting relationships with stakeholders.

Management is understood in different ways by different people. Economists regard it as a factor of production. Sociologists see it was a class or group of persons while practitioners of management treat it as a process. For our understand management may be viewed as what a manager does in a formal organization to achieve the objectives. It is called bee by Mary Parker Follet: “The art of getting things done through people”. This definition throws light on the fact that managers achieve organizational goals by enabling others to perform rather than performing the tasks themselves.The writer emphasizes on the project management skills with a maiden of “Scrum project management skills”.
